CheckerFramework type system for Data Classification

A Java compiler plugin that checks that that data of a certain classification can only be passed to functions that are also classified as being able to handle that data.

This plugin works via pluggable type-checking: you specify types (data classification) and the plugin verifies the code. The plugin is sound, meaning that it never misses an error: if the checker reports that the code is safe, you can be confident that it is. However, it might report false positive warnings.

How do I run it?

To build the plugin and run its tests: ./gradlew check This should result in a BUILD SUCCESSFUL message.

For a quick start, try running it on a single file which will highlight the checks that the checker is making and how they are failing:

(Note that you may need to set your JAVA_HOME environment variable to point to your JDK8 home directory then call javac using $JAVA_HOME/bin/javac)

./gradlew assemble
./gradlew copyDependencies

javac -cp \
./build/libs/data_classification_checker.jar:dependencies/checker-2.10.0.jar \
-processor com.amazon.checkerframework.checker.data_classification.DataClassificationChecker \
tests/data_classification/Aliases.java
